Why is the concept of being earthen vessels important for Christians?

Answered in 2 sources

Being earthen vessels reminds Christians of their dependence on God and His grace, rather than their own strength.

The metaphor of earthen vessels serves as a humbling reminder of our human frailty and the limitations of our abilities. In Christian theology, this concept is vital because it directs our focus away from self-reliance towards dependence on God's power and purposes. When Paul writes about our frailty, he emphasizes that the extraordinary work of the gospel is accomplished through us, not due to our strength or worthiness. This helps believers recognize the grace of God, who uses imperfect vessels to accomplish His divine will and purposes, thus reinforcing the idea that our significance comes from Christ within us.
Scripture References: 2 Corinthians 4:7
